Retailing in Southern Africa
Authors: N Cunningham, S Pillay
Format: Physical Hardcopy
The retail industry is one of the most significant contributors to South Africa’s economy, both in terms of sales and as the second largest employer in the country. It is rapidly evolving, driven by advancements in technology, changes in consumer behaviour and economic shifts, particularly post the COVID-19 pandemic, with retailers striving to stay competitive in an increasingly digital and global marketplace. Retailing in Southern Africa is designed to provide a comprehensive understanding of the contemporary retail industry within the unique context of southern Africa.
Retailing in Southern Africa examines the different components of the retailing industry, providing insights that are directly applicable to the local market and addressing specific challenges and opportunities faced by retailers in the region. Each chapter is enriched with real-world examples and case studies, making the content not only informative, but also practical.
